QA Manager Jobs in North Carolina

A Quality Assurance (QA) Manager in the manufacturing industry is responsible for overseeing the quality of products and processes within the facility. This person will coordinate and supervise activities that ensure design, manufacturing, and testing processes meet the company's quality standards. They will establish procedures for quality control, lead internal audits of the quality systems, and ensure regulatory compliance. QA Managers are also involved in troubleshooting problems, implementing corrective actions, and training staff on new procedures and protocols. They are an integral part of the team, working closely with other departments to promote a culture of quality within the organization.

Important skills for a QA Manager include excellent communication and leadership abilities, strong analytical and problem-solving skills, and a detailed understanding of quality control methods and regulations. Furthermore, proficiency in statistical analysis and quality control software is highly advantageous. As for certifications, Certified Quality Engineer (CQE), Certified Six Sigma Black Belt (CSSBB), and Certified Manager of Quality/Organizational Excellence (CMQ/OE) are often preferred. Prior roles in the career path to becoming a QA Manager might include Quality Control Inspector, Quality Assurance Analyst, or Quality Engineer.

Highest Education Level

QA Managers in North Carolina off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
33.8%
High School or GED
21.5%
Master's Degree
17.7%
Vocational Degree or Certification
11.6%
Associate's Degree
11.5%
Some College
1.7%
Doctorate Degree
1.4%
Some High School
0.7%
